xcode8.0 ios8.2 APP在后台收不到推送

ios
收不到消息
标签: #<Tag:0x00007fb8316ca318> #<Tag:0x00007fb8316ca1d8>

#1

APP在前台时,收到推送的时候可以进入 - (void)application:(UIApplication *)application didReceiveRemoteNotification:(NSDictionary *)userInfo fetchCompletionHandler:(void (^)(UIBackgroundFetchResult))completionHandler 这个方法,但是在后台的时候 进不了这个方法。


#2

后台的状态具体是?
Background remote Notification消息是有要求的

是指怎么 进不了这个方法?

对这个消息的解读:


#3

按手机home键,APP回到后台,发送这种推送,进不去- (void)application:(UIApplication *)application didReceiveRemoteNotification:(NSDictionary *)userInfo fetchCompletionHandler:(void (^)(UIBackgroundFetchResult))completionHandler 这个方法


#4

首先是你究竟收到这条消息了没有,收到了消息就会走这个方法。
但点击app图标 这个操作不会去调用这个方法。

看你是说的进不去 指的是什么时候?怎么判断进不去


#5

我要做静默推送,发现APP在前台的时候静默推送是没问题的,但是APP在后台的时候静默推送就不行了


#6

这个有一定频率控制

苹果官方原文


#7

行我明天再测试一下,不过最近一直都不行